diff --git a/gtk/theme/HighContrast/_drawing.scss b/gtk/theme/HighContrast/_drawing.scss index 330cb2e67c..4cb8b29d6d 100644 --- a/gtk/theme/HighContrast/_drawing.scss +++ b/gtk/theme/HighContrast/_drawing.scss @@ -1,6 +1,10 @@ // Drawing mixins // generic drawing of more complex things +@function _widget_edge($c:$borders_edge) { +// outer highlight "used" on most widgets + @return 0 1px $c; +} @mixin _shadows($shadow1, $shadow2:none, $shadow3:none, $shadow4:none) { // diff --git a/gtk/theme/HighContrast/gtk.css b/gtk/theme/HighContrast/gtk.css index 7fec7d4f94..c244425251 100644 --- a/gtk/theme/HighContrast/gtk.css +++ b/gtk/theme/HighContrast/gtk.css @@ -2542,13 +2542,13 @@ GtkInfoBar { * Color Chooser * *****************/ GtkColorSwatch { - box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), _widget_edge(); } + box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), 0 1px #fff; } :selected GtkColorSwatch { box-shadow: none; } :selected GtkColorSwatch.overlay, :selected GtkColorSwatch.overlay:hover { border-color: #fff; } GtkColorSwatch:selected { - box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), _widget_edge(); } + box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), 0 1px #fff; } GtkColorSwatch.top { border-top-left-radius: 5px; border-top-right-radius: 5px; } @@ -2573,7 +2573,7 @@ GtkColorSwatch { border-radius: 3px; } GtkColorEditor GtkColorSwatch:hover { background-image: none; - box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), _widget_edge(); } + box-shadow: inset 0 1px rgba(0, 0, 0, 0.1), 0 1px #fff; } GtkColorEditor GtkColorSwatch:backdrop { box-shadow: none; } GtkColorSwatch.color-dark {